"The Story of the Philippines" by Murat Halstead is a comprehensive look at the natural riches, industrial resources, statistics of productions, commerce, and population of the Philippines. This book delves into the laws, habits, customs, scenery, and conditions of the archipelagoes of India, Hawaii, and the "Cuba of the East Indies." With episodes of their early history, this book is an exploration of the Eldorado of the Orient.

Featuring personal character sketches and interviews with notable figures such as Admiral Dewey, General Merritt, General Aguinaldo, and the Archbishop of Manila, this book offers a unique perspective on the history and romance, tragedies and traditions of our Pacific possessions.

From the events of the war in the West with Spain to the conquest of Cuba and Porto Rico, "The Story of the Philippines" provides a captivating account of this fascinating region.
